1. You can start your car from an extended distance
You require a key that is programmed to start your vehicle. The key must have a microchip that can be read by the receiver in the ignition. When the key is inserted it sends out a signal to the receiver that is in line with the code on the chip. If the signal matches with the chip, the car will start. This method is more secure than other methods of locking your car because the code is constantly changing and cannot be deciphered.
With the advent of a programmable key, it is now impossible to hot-wire your car and drive away. A majority of these vehicles have proximity sensors that stop the car from starting in the event that the key isn't within range.

A programmable car key differs from a traditional mechanical key that has grooves and cuts that can be inserted into your car's ignition or door locks. It also comes with a computer chip connected to the car's computer. The chip is programmed by a locksmith, or dealer or auto manufacturer based on the model and make of your vehicle. Typically, this process is more complicated than creating duplicates of the traditional key. It takes longer and costs you more. There are ways to save money on this service.
Local locksmiths can program your programmable keys for less than the dealership and are often faster. However, you will require two functioning keys in order for the locksmith to connect your new key to your car's computer system. A lot of modern cars also have advanced anti-theft systems that must be programmed by an authorized locksmith or dealer.
